使用 psycopg2 返回一个值
理想情况下,我希望能够执行以下操作: id_of_new_row = cursor.lastrowid() 其中我获取新创建或修改的行的 id。但这不能通过 psycopg2 获得。或者,…
Django 的问题mod-wsgi +心理咨询师2
所以我第一次尝试让 Django 与 mod-wsgi 一起运行。我已经按照示例中所示配置了 Apache,并且我非常确定我所做的一切都是正确的。 我没有设置 PYTHON_…
转义 SQL“LIKE” Postgres 与 psycopg2 的值
psycopg2 是否具有转义 Postgres 的 LIKE 操作数值的函数? 例如,我可能想要匹配以字符串“20% of all”开头的字符串,因此我想编写如下内容: sql =…
在 Django/Postgresql 中调试活锁
我在 Django 上使用 Apache2、mod_python 和带有 postgresql_psycopg2 数据库后端的 PostgreSQL 8.3 运行一个相当流行的 Web 应用程序。我偶尔会遇到…
如何为时间戳(日期时间)数组指定 psycopg2 参数
我想使用 psycopg2 在 Python 中运行 PostgreSQL 查询,该查询按 timestamp without timezone 类型的列进行过滤。我有一个很长的时间戳允许值列表(而…
在 Snow Leopard 上安装 PostgreSQL 和 pyscopg2
我在 Web 开发领域仍然是一个完全的初学者,我正在尝试设置 Django 环境。我正在阅读《django 权威指南》来开始我的实践。 我在 MacBook 2.1GHz 上运…
直接在 Python 中重新创建 Postgres COPY?
我有一个数据块,目前是 n 元组列表,但格式非常灵活,我想将其附加到 Postgres 表中 - 在这种情况下,每个 n 元组对应于数据库中的一行。 到目前为止…
psycopg2 与 sys.stdin.read()
我有如下的小代码: #!/usr/bin/python import psycopg2, sys try: conn = psycopg2.connect("dbname='smdr' user='bino'"); except: print "I am una…
为什么 psycopg2 不执行我的任何 SQL 函数? (索引错误:元组索引超出范围)
我将以最简单的 SQL 函数为例: CREATE OR REPLACE FUNCTION skater_name_match(INTEGER,VARCHAR) RETURNS BOOL AS $$ SELECT $1 IN (SELECT skaters_…
psycopg2 和 mod_python 导入错误
我正在尝试在 Windows XP 计算机上设置 roundup 。 我使用 psycopg2 v2.0.13,当我从 shell 导入 psycopg2 模块时,一切正常,但是当 mod_python 尝试…
Pylons 导入 Psycopg2 错误
Traceback (most recent call last): File "", line 1, in File "/Library/Python/2.6/site-packages/psycopg2/__init__.py", line 60, in from _psy…
处理守护线程上的数据库连接
我在处理我一直在处理的守护进程中的数据库连接时遇到问题,我首先连接到我的 postgres 数据库: try: psycopg2.apilevel = '2.0' psycopg2.threadsaf…